Practical Considerations for Stitching
Transitioning from digital screen to physical thread requires technical attention. When working with Spirit Filled Sports Embroidery Font - S, there are several practical concerns to address to ensure a high-quality finished product.
Fabric and Stabilizer Choice: Because this is a bold, filled font, it carries more weight than a simple running-stitch alphabet. On stretchy baby clothes or thin tote bag materials, using a cut-away stabilizer is crucial to prevent puckering. For thicker blankets, a tear-away might suffice, but always test first. The crisp edges mentioned in the product description rely on stable fabric; if the material shifts, those clean lines will blur.
Thread Colors and Contrast: The outline feature of this embroidery font allows for creative color play. You can match the fill and outline for a monochromatic, subtle look, or choose contrasting thread colors to make the text pop. On dark fabric, ensure your fill stitches are dense enough to cover the background completely. I recommend creating a test stitch-out on a scrap piece of your actual project fabric to check how the thread colors interact with the material dye.
Stitch Density and Detail: While the description highlights tall, thick letters, always review the specific stitch density in your embroidery software before loading the file to your machine. High density can lead to needle breaks or fabric stiffness, especially in smaller sizes. If you are stitching small lettering, zoom in on your screen to ensure the details remain distinct. Delicate shapes can sometimes merge if the resolution isn't high enough or if the thread tension is too loose.
